Ganduje sends six commissioner – nominees to legistators
Kano State Governor, Abdullahi Umar Ganduje has forwarded a list of six commissioner designates to the state House of Assembly for confirmation.
Among the new commissioner hopeful are Musa Illiasu Kwankwaso, a political associate of former governor Ibrahim Shekarau who had defected to All Progressives Congress (APC).
Presenting the governor’s letter of nomination before the members, Speaker of the House, Yusuf Abdullahi Ata, revealed that the House received the list of six commissioner nominees from governor Ganduje for confirmation.
Reading the letter during plenary, he said the other names are: Aminu Aliyu, Aminu Mukhtar Dan Amu, Ibrahim Muhd, Aishattu Jaafar and Ahmed Rabiu.
Ata announced that the nominees are to appear in the House for screening.
Ganduje may not leave any stones unturned to realign the political structure of APC in Kano ahead of 2019 with the major cabinet restructure in the state executive council.
